Architectural and Design Elements of Classic Slot Machines
One compelling aspect of vintage slot machines—their iconic cabinet design—continues to influence modern recreations. These machines often feature robust wood or faux-wood finishes, decorative borders, and luminous displays that mimic the glow of real incandescent bulbs. The tactile experience—the push of physical buttons, the spinning of mechanical reels—adds an engaging layer absent from purely virtual games.

The Technical and Artistic Challenge of Authentic Recreation
Capturing the essence of traditional slot cabinets in a digital environment involves meticulous attention to detail. Developers often study vintage machines extensively, analyzing aspects such as:
- Cabinet structure: Solid frames, decorative motifs, and branding
- Display features: Mechanical reels vs. digital simulations, LED lighting effects
- Sound design: Ambient noises, coin insert sounds, reel spins, and jingles

The Industry’s Pedigree with Nostalgic Machine Design
| Feature | Classic Merkur Cabinets | Modern Digital Reproductions |
|---|---|---|
| Exterior Finish | Wood veneer, bold branding | High-resolution graphics simulating wood textures |
| Reel Mechanics | Mechanical reels with physical rotation | Simulated reels with fluid animation |
| Lighting Effects | Incandescent bulbs, flickering lights | LED lighting synchronized with gameplay |
| Sound Design | Mechanical sounds, coin clinks | High-fidelity sound effects matching vintage cues |
